How Ireland’s PR Works

Add Zee News as a Preferred Source


The programme is open to non-EU/EEA citizens who wish to live, work and study in Ireland. Residency for five years is a core requirement, setting the stage for eventual citizenship.

During this period, applicants must hold a Critical Skills Employment Permit, granting them the right to live and work in Ireland for two years.

Following this, they can apply for a Stamp 4 visa, allowing an additional three years of residence. Successfully completing this pathway opens the door to long-term residency.

Eligibility Criteria

To apply for Irish PR, candidates must meet these requirements:

  • A minimum of 60 months of legal residence in Ireland.
  • A valid employment permit, such as the General Employment Permit, for most of their stay.
  • Legal employment at the time of application.
  • Clean criminal record and good character.
  • Sufficient financial resources.
  • Compliance with all previous immigration conditions.

Step-by-Step Application Process

Confirm Eligibility: Complete five years of residence with employment and a critical skills permit. Ensure good character and financial stability.

Prepare Documents: Include the completed application form, valid passport, current Irish Residence Permit (IRP) card, all employment permits from your time in Ireland and your certificate of registration.

Submit Application: Apply through the Immigration Service Delivery (ISD).

Pay the Fee: The application fee is 500 Euros (approximately Rs 51,254), payable within 28 days of receiving the approval letter.

Wait for Processing: Long-term residency applications typically take six to eight months to process.

Receive Approval: Successful applicants gain long-term residency status on a Stamp 4 visa, enabling continued residence and work in Ireland.
